Heritage & Character

Heritage & Character

Ashaka, deeply rooted in Ndokwa traditions, showcases a blend of agricultural heritage and emerging commercial activity. The community's identity is closely tied to its ancestral lands and the cultivation of crops like yam and cassava. Traditional festivals and cultural events are integral to Ashaka's social fabric, preserving the customs and values passed down through generations. The local dialect and folklore further enrich the town's unique cultural tapestry, making it a vibrant center of Ndokwa heritage.

Infrastructure & Access

Infrastructure & Access

Ashaka's infrastructure is developing, with the Kwale-Ashaka Road serving as a crucial transport artery. The road facilitates the movement of goods and people, connecting Ashaka to larger commercial centers. Ongoing efforts are focused on improving road networks within the town. Access to utilities like electricity and water is gradually expanding to meet the needs of the growing population. The presence of schools and healthcare facilities, such as the General Hospital Ashaka, supports the well-being of the community, contributing to the town's overall development.

Overview of Ashaka

Ashaka is an emerging town in the Ndokwa East Local Government Area of Delta State, known for its agricultural activities and growing commercial presence. With a focus on agriculture and a developing entrepreneurial spirit, Ashaka offers a blend of rural charm and economic opportunity. Location & Accessibility

Ashaka is located along the Kwale-Ashaka Road, which is a key transportation route facilitating trade and connectivity with neighboring towns. This road provides access to Kwale, a larger commercial center, and other parts of Delta State. The town's location is advantageous for agricultural trade and transportation.

Property Market in Ashaka

The real estate market in Ashaka is characterized by affordable options, primarily focusing on residential properties and land for agricultural use. Homes for sale in Ashaka typically range from ₦7 million to ₦12 million, offering excellent value for money. Rental properties are also available, with average rents around ₦400,000 to ₦600,000 per year.
